About

This series follows the legend of Wilhelm Gorkeit of Tellikon (William Tell), who, as the stories say, shot an apple off of his son's head and lead the rebellion to free Switzerland.

1. Shaytana's Eye

52m

The peaceful Kingdom of Kale is thrown into chaos after the Citadel is overthrown by the dark forces of Kreel and Xax. After his family farm is destroyed by the Xaxian army, young William Tell is visited by the mystical Kalem who reveals that he has been chosen to seek the legendary Crystal Arrow, which is the key to saving the Princess Vara and her Kingdom.

2. The Fifth Column

52m

After their escape from the mines, William and his newfound friends from the rebel forces - Leon, Aruna and Drogo continue their journey to obtain the mythical Crystal Arrow. But Princess Vara seems to think she is better suited on the throne beside Xax who seems to be remaining hot on their trail. It soon becomes clear that there is a traitor amidst the group. But who is it?

3. Escape into Fear

52m

William and the rebels suspect Xax is plotting with Kreel who has a reputation of delivering powerful, dark magic. After Princess Vara escapes during a battle with Xaxian warriors, William is conflicted when he discovers that there is a bounty on his head and villagers are threatened with execution unless he gives himself up.

4. Darkness and Light

52m

William's bold plan to infiltrate the Citadel goes wrong when Leon is arrested after being caught talking to Alexim in the marketplace. Rather than executing Leon immediately, Kreel holds him prisoner as bait. But will William and the rebel forces fall to Kreel and Xax's nefarious plans?

5. Hidden Valley

52m

The group seeks refuge in the Hidden Valley, but they soon discover that the water supply has been contaminated with a powerful hypnotic substance, which has turned the once peaceful village into an army of willing slaves. William is positive Xax and Kreel are behind it all, but there is something more to it than simply William's capture.

6. The Challenge

52m

A statue of Xax with crystal eyes has been placed in every village as a form of surveillance for Kreel and Xax to spy over the kingdom. Lalia refuses to worship the idol and is taken prisoner. Will discovers the type of crystal that is being used to transmit the images and seeks to destroy the mine that it is sourced from. But there is also a mystery to be resolved with Lalia.
